The NHRC is India’s apex statutory body for the protection and promotion of human rights, established under the Protection of Human Rights Act, 1993. Since 1998, NHRC has regularly conducted internship programs to raise awareness and build capacity among students regarding human rights issues, legal frameworks, and advocacy practices.
The Online Short Term Internship Programme (OSTI) is a two-week, full-time internship designed to provide university-level students with deep insights into human rights protection and promotion in India.
Eligibility Criteria
- Students in the 3rd year or above of a 5-year integrated PG course
- Students in the 3rd or final year of a graduation course
- Students in any semester/year of any post-graduate degree or diploma course
- Research scholars in any stream
- Interactive lectures and webinars by human rights experts
- Group discussions, case studies, and project assignments
- Exposure to real-world human rights issues and NHRC’s role in addressing them
- Stipend: ₹2,000 upon successful completion
- Certificate: E-certificate from NHRC, valuable for your academic and professional portfolio
